Spectrally resolved pump-probe measurement of pure water at 274 K for (a) parallel polarization between pump and probe, and (b) perpendicular polarization between pump and probe. (c) Pump probe cross-sections integrated across the v1–2 transition (3,050–3,150 cm−1) for parallel (green) and perpendicular (blue) polarizations. (d) Pump probe cross-sections integrated across the v0–1 transition (3,300–3,600 cm−1) for parallel (black) and perpendicular (red) polarizations.
